ALSA: azt3328: Use managed buffer allocation
authorTakashi Iwai <tiwai@suse.de>
Mon, 9 Dec 2019 09:48:59 +0000 (10:48 +0100)
committerTakashi Iwai <tiwai@suse.de>
Wed, 11 Dec 2019 06:25:06 +0000 (07:25 +0100)
Clean up the driver with the new managed buffer allocation API.
The hw_params and hw_free callbacks became superfluous and got
dropped.
